Remove one-to-one part/result to puzzle relationship based on puzzle_name. Instead, Tags puzzle_name:_PUZZLES_TAG_CATEGORY are used for matching. This allows to use older PuzzlePartObjects in newly created puzzles by adding the new puzzles' puzzle_name:_PUZZLES_TAG_CATEGORY tag to the old objects.

When creating proto parts and results, honor obj.home, obj.permissions, and obj.locks, and obj.tags

def test_e2e_interchangeable_parts_and_results(self):
# Parts and Results can be used in multiple puzzles
egg = create_object(key='egg', location=self.char1.location)
flour = create_object(key='flour', location=self.char1.location)
boiling_water = create_object(key='boiling water', location=self.char1.location)
boiled_egg = create_object(key='boiled egg', location=self.char1.location)
dough = create_object(key='dough', location=self.char1.location)
pasta = create_object(key='pasta', location=self.char1.location)
# Three recipes:
# 1. breakfast: egg + boiling water = boiled egg & boiling water
# 2. dough: egg + flour = dough
# 3. entree: dough + boiling water = pasta & boiling water
# tag interchangeable parts according to their puzzles' name
egg.tags.add('breakfast', category=puzzles._PUZZLES_TAG_CATEGORY)
egg.tags.add('dough', category=puzzles._PUZZLES_TAG_CATEGORY)
dough.tags.add('entree', category=puzzles._PUZZLES_TAG_CATEGORY)
boiling_water.tags.add('breakfast', category=puzzles._PUZZLES_TAG_CATEGORY)
boiling_water.tags.add('entree', category=puzzles._PUZZLES_TAG_CATEGORY)
# create recipes
recipe1_dbref = self._good_recipe('breakfast', ['egg', 'boiling water'], ['boiled egg', 'boiling water'] , and_destroy_it=False)
recipe2_dbref = self._good_recipe('dough', ['egg', 'flour'], ['dough'] , and_destroy_it=False, expected_count=2)
recipe3_dbref = self._good_recipe('entree', ['dough', 'boiling water'], ['pasta', 'boiling water'] , and_destroy_it=False, expected_count=3)
